Facade cladding installation involves applying a protective and decorative outer layer to the exterior walls of a building. This service typically includes selecting appropriate cladding materials, preparing the surface, and securely attaching the panels or coverings to ensure durability and aesthetic appeal. The process helps improve the overall look of a property while providing an extra layer of protection against weather elements, such as rain, wind, and temperature fluctuations. Homeowners interested in enhancing their property's curb appeal or upgrading an aging exterior may find facade cladding installation to be a practical solution.

One of the primary benefits of facade cladding is its ability to address common exterior problems. Over time, buildings may experience issues like cracked or peeling paint, water infiltration, or damage caused by exposure to harsh weather conditions. Cladding can help seal these vulnerabilities, reducing the risk of water leaks and structural deterioration. Additionally, it can improve insulation, making a home more energy-efficient and comfortable. The overview below groups typical Facade Cladding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Milford, NH.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or facade cladding repairs in Milford often range from $250-$600. Many routine maintenance jobs fall within this band, depending on the extent of the work needed.

Partial Replacement - Replacing sections of cladding us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000 for most projects. Larger, more complex partial replacements can reach $4,000 or more, though these are less common.

Full Facade Replacement - Complete cladding replacement for a standard-sized building generally falls between $8,000 and $20,000. Larger or intricate projects can exceed $25,000, with many jobs landing in the middle ranges.

Custom or Large-Scale Projects - Extensive or highly customized facade cladding installations can cost $30,000 or more. These projects are less frequent but represent the upper end of typical pricing for local contractors.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of facade cladding materials do local contractors install? Local contractors typically install a variety of facade cladding materials, including vinyl, fiber cement, metal panels, brick veneer, and stone, to suit different architectural styles and preferences.

How do I know if facade cladding installation is suitable for my building? A consultation with a local service provider can help determine if facade cladding is appropriate based on your building’s structure, climate considerations, and aesthetic goals.

What preparation is needed before installing facade cladding? Preparation may include inspecting the existing exterior, addressing any structural issues, and ensuring proper surface cleaning to ensure the cladding adheres properly.

Are there different installation methods for various facade cladding materials? Yes, installation methods vary depending on the material, with some requiring fastening to a subframe, while others may be adhered directly to the surface, depending on the product specifications.

What maintenance is required after facade cladding installation? Maintenance requirements depend on the material used but generally include regular cleaning and inspections to address any damage or wear over time.
